Swansea is the largest city in the Lake Macquarie region of New South Wales.
The main industries in the region are coal mining and fishing, while a large number of other residents commute to nearby Newcastle for work.
However, a small number the 15,000 population remain involved in tourism.
Guests staying at hotels in Swansea can enjoy several nearby beaches.
The city has the advantage of being located on a peninsula.
Therefore, it offers access to beaches on the Pacific Ocean coastline, as well as boating on the more sheltered Lake Macquarie.
Caves Beach is one of the most interesting beaches.
Visitors can walk through the beach's caves while the tide is out.
Cycling is also a popular pastime; there are miles of dedicated cycle paths around the city.
Buses to Swansea depart from Newcastle and Sydney on a regular basis.
The journey from Newcastle takes only 20 minutes, while Sydney is nearly two hours away.
Air travellers can also fly to nearby airports in Newcastle and Williamstown.
